She began her career as an actress in the theater, in the Dante Testa company. In 1910, together with her sister Letizia, she was hired by Itala Film, but her film debut took place in the same year in the short film L'ignota produced by Aquila Films. 1914 is the year of her artistic consecration with the interpretation in the film Cabiria, which also makes her gain international fame. Between 1915 and 1920 he starred in several films, produced by other film companies; among these we remember the film The three sentimental. After this film he moved to Fert, for which he acted in some films. She died in 1928, aged 36, of a bout of pneumonia. She is buried in the Monumental Cemetery of Turin.
